Beiben Achieves 10,194 Units Truck Sales in the First 11 Months of 2017
On November 29, Beiben Heavy-duty Truck Company, also known as Beiben, held its Suppliers’ Meeting in Baotou. At the meeting, the company announced that it secured orders with a combined sales volume of 11,168 units trucks as of the end of November this year, up by 51.72% year on year. From January to November, its sales volume stood at 10,194 units, up by 63% year on year. In the meantime, its production volume reached 11,604 units, up by 78% year on year. In addition, the sales of its trucks exceeded that of its self-dumping vehicles for the first time, showing the company’s restructuring efforts are paying off.
In its overseas markets, Beiben secured orders with a combined sales of 1,894 units, up by 29.46% year on year. Its export volume stood at 1,634 units, up by 21.75% year on year. Such an impressive achievement was made thanks to its continued efforts in building its own export platform and strengthening its marketing networks abroad.
Specifically, Beiben sold nearly 2,000 units V3ET trucks and 4,000 units V3MT economical trucks. In addition, Beiben construction waste transport vehicles made considerable gains with its sales reaching nearly 3,000 units. In Baotou alone, the local government bought 429 units sanitation vehicles from Beiben.
In 2018, Beiben will continue to give priorities to strengthening its market presence, developing quality products and improving customer service, aiming to increase its annual sales target to 20,000 units. (www.chinatrucks.com)
